    I think the reason LED's are not used very often for audio jacks is because Expert Sleepers is achieving this by using a small SMD LED mounted on the PCB just underneath the audio jack that is mounted horizontal on the PCB. So the LED shines into the side of this type of audio jack that uses translucent plastic. This is why the light appears more intense on the left side of the jack.

    after you power off then back on does the mk4 recall its last settings?

    • @homeslice1479
      @homeslice1479 4 роки тому +1

      The Disting can save 64 presets, which saves the algo and all parameters. But I'm gonna copy from the manual for further explanation about preset 0:
      Preset 0, the first slot, is special:
      • The contents of preset 0 are loaded at power-up.
      • When switching algorithm, the new algorithm state is saved to preset 0.*
      Therefore if you want to save the disting's state so it powers up as it is currently, you can manually
      save to preset 0, which is “click, turn, click, click” on the encoder.
      Preset 0 is also an exception to the above comment regarding favourites. The actual favourites slot
      is stored.
      *The thinking here is that if you forget to save your preset before turning off the power, at least the disting will come
      back up in the same algorithm next time you start.
